文摘Objective: To explore a new way for developing the human umbilical cord blood (CB) engraftment with high efficiency and in further understand the homing potentiality of hematopoietic stein/progenitor cells (HSC/HPC). Method: Sub-lethally irradiated severe combined immunodeficient (SCID) mice were transplanted i. v. with CB which was cryopre- served at - 80℃. Human cells in recipient mice were detected by flow cytometry and CFU-GM assay for each host organ. Results: In contrast with the single transplantation, scheduled engraftment of the identical numbers of CB cells resulted in an obvious increase of CD45+ and CD34+ cells produced in SCID mouse bone marrow (BM). While the donor cells were reduced by 5 times, the similar reconstitution of both hematopoietic fumctions and part of immunologic fumctions was ob- tained.Conclusion:Scheduled engraftment can improve repopulating of the HSC, which provides a novel way for clinical cord blood engraftment into adults.
